Output 4faa4106fb2805d52ad8fd6e5fad2d015c1d7ee71d9320a76ccc710e71f98595:30

value
143870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9497af8aa5f396a4ff89faf856e088f06bf2579c OP_EQUAL
address
3FEheF23whcLMcxwu59MdSH1zfqaeE7p3S
transaction
4faa4106fb2805d52ad8fd6e5fad2d015c1d7ee71d9320a76ccc710e71f98595